// Heads up, support folks: this constant controls when Mailhopper bundles
// pending notifications into the daily digest for Quillbrook workspaces.
// If a customer says their digest "arrived late," check whether their
// workspace timezone was set before 02:00 local — anything after that
// slips to the next cycle. Changing this requires a redeploy, so don't
// promise instant fixes. When escalating, include the token below so
// the Mailhopper crew can match your report to the exact build.

session token of tajef-bageg = htk21_5d90d574934f3ccae6437

Finance Review — Second-Source Supplier Search

Department heads: the search for a second source on the Veltrix housing line is complete. Three candidates screened; Korbany Fabrication (Densfield) is the preferred option on cost and lead time. Qualification run budgeted at 4% of Q3 procurement spend. Marwick Components remains sole source until audit clears. Risk: tooling transfer adds six weeks. Decision required by month-end. Implications for the broader sourcing strategy are summarized in the confidential note below.

management briefing: Project Ulavan slips by two quarters because of the staffing delay.

# Heads up, reviewer: this env drives the nightly inventory
# reconciliation job for Cratewise. It diffs warehouse counts against
# the Orlo ledger and files adjustment records for anything off by
# more than RECON_TOLERANCE units. Don't lower the tolerance without
# pinging the ops channel first — tiny thresholds flood the adjustment
# queue. The job writes adjustments back through the ledger API, and
# the line right below this comment sets the token it uses for that.

secret setting of yajog-taguf: ARCHIVE_KEY3=051

Subject: Deep-link routing for the Pintail handoff

Hi folks,

Welcome aboard! Quick primer on how Pintail routes deep links from your Marbury app into ours. Links matching the veloway:// scheme get parsed by our RouteBroker, which maps paths to in-app screens — anything unrecognized falls back to the storefront home. For testing, point your builds at the sandbox router; it logs every resolution so you can see exactly where a link landed.

The sandbox rejects anonymous calls, so attach the bearer token below to every request.

Cheers,
Dorit

session JWT of yawep-yawep = eyJhbGciOiJIUzI1NiIsInR5cCI6IkpXVCJ9.eyJzdWIiOiI3pWF3_In0.aXYsHiog